Services Offered by Furnace Repair Companies
Your local furnace repair provider offers a number of services to help your system work efficiently and effectively. We’ve outlined the most common ones below.
Repair and Maintenance
Timely professional repairs restore your furnace's function, extend its life span, and optimize energy efficiency. Furnace repair experts are trained to deal with broken blower motors, clogged air filters, malfunctioning thermostats, and more. Your technician can diagnose and repair problems like these to keep your furnace running efficiently. A qualified HVAC technician can also help with issues like possible gas leaks, damaged heat exchangers, faulty ignitions, or malfunctioning thermostats. Your furnace repair company can also complete routine HVAC system upkeep to help avoid unnecessary breakdowns. Your technician will ensure that all components function properly by inspecting your furnace, cleaning it, lubricating moving parts, and replacing air filters.
Installation
HVAC companies can also install a new furnace if your furnace is beyond repair, or if you want to upgrade to a more energy-efficient model, like a heat pump. Skilled technicians will first assess your home's layout and heating needs. Then, they recommend the most suitable furnace model based on your budget and home requirements. Your HVAC technician can integrate your new system with existing air ducts and thermostats. They're trained on industry safety protocols and standards to ensure proper furnace replacement and connection. To be sure everything is running optimally, your technician will complete a final inspection after installation.
Inspection
You probably need an inspection if you discover that your furnace isn’t turning on. A technician will thoroughly inspect each part of the furnace to look for potential problems. Inspections typically include cleaning and replacing air filters, checking for any gas or fuel leaks, examining the heat exchanger for cracks or damage, testing the thermostat's accuracy, and inspecting the burner and ignition system. We recommend an annual inspection, during which a technician will check your heating system's safety and efficiency while making any necessary repairs or adjustments. Regular inspections and tune-ups help avoid potential breakdowns, ensure optimal heating performance, and promote safe living during chilly winters.
Emergency Services
If your furnace breaks down on a cold winter night, some furnace repair companies provide emergency repair services to get your heat back up and running as soon as possible. These services are available around the clock for unexpected breakdowns, malfunctions, and other safety concerns. Emergency services are more expensive than scheduled services, but it's worth it to protect your health. Furnace failure can lead to serious discomfort and health risks due to reduced indoor air quality, especially if it breaks down during extreme weather conditions when you're unable to open windows for fresh air.
Factors To Consider When Choosing a Local New Lenox Furnace Repair Service
There are several important considerations to keep in mind when choosing a local New Lenox furnace repair company. We go over some of the most important below.
- Cost: Look for a company that provides all the services you need, and that offers transparent and competitive pricing. We recommend comparing several New Lenox furnace repair providers. Avoid ones with extremely low rates, as they may employ low-quality workmanship or subpar replacement parts.
- Guarantees: Check for guarantees or warranties offered by your furnace repair provider. A trustworthy company should back its work with guarantees on repairs and replacement parts. This assurance provides peace of mind knowing you can rely on your service provider if any issues arise after repairs.
- Licensing: You want to use a furnace repair provider that holds all the required licenses and certifications. In Illinois, your HVAC contractor must obtain certification from your local city or municipal government. Proper licensing ensures that technicians are qualified and trained to safely handle furnace repairs.
- Qualifications: Check a furnace repair company's qualifications and experience. Ideally, technicians should be well-trained and have expertise in various furnace makes and models. Ask about ongoing training programs to ensure a company keeps up with current repair techniques.
- Reputation and reviews: Read online testimonials and reviews to get an idea of a company's reputation. Overall positive reviews are indicative of quality services. You can also verify a company's commitment to customer satisfaction by looking at how it addresses negative feedback or complaints.
How Much Does a Furnace Repair Cost?
The cost of furnace repair is based on multiple factors, including HVAC unit type, the extent of the damage, and the price of replacement parts. The average furnace repair costs $446, but your total price depends on the situation. The following are some common furnace repairs, as well as their average costs.
- Broken thermostat: $82–$408
- Cleaning: $49–$65
- Cracked heat exchanger: $1,630–$2,853
- Damaged blower bearings: $24–$122
- Damaged blower belt: $24–$90
- Filter change: $33–$122
